How old is that puppy ?
Hope it was atleast 8-weeks before being seperated from it's mom.

With regards to what breed it is, a mixed (crossBreed) dog has no breed though sellers could coin a breedName for it e.g a Boerboel + GermanSherp mix could be called BoerboelSherperd; but in reality, they have no specific breed, and there's never any certainity such dog would have up to 30% traits from each parents. Genetics dey somehow.

Funny thing is, there's every possibility & probability either or both parents are (very) imPure. now imagine the result of crossBreeding such animal ?

When you love an animal, it's breed is hardly a concern.

With regards to what to feed him/her, there's JO-JO dog food, smoked or parboiled fish, indomie, rice, beans, etc. There are Canned foods for dogs though don't know your financial capacity.

What I would suggest is, go to where they sell chicken in Kilo, ask them if they have Chicken legs, and chicken heads. if they don't ask them where you can buy such. if they fail to tell you, keep asking till you get a source. Buy the chicken heads and legs which is much more cheaper.

Also please avoid giving Fish or meat with bones. You might have been made to believe Dogs like bones, same way they made us believe rabbits love Carrots, and cats love milk but if you own Cats, you would know the wonders milk could do to them.

You don't want a pet whose a picky eater. it's now, at this very early stage you train it on what to feed on. Even if you're very wealthy, ensure you feed it loal food so you wouldn't be on your toes whenever you're low on funds.
I sugest you equally add multiVitamins to it's water on daily or weekly basis. Don't worry, the multiVitamins mustn't be specifically made for dogs, those for humans (especially babies) are very okay.

Ask the seller if the dog have been taken to vet to get it's shots. if No, please do so asap. it's not costly and would help the dog in the long run. Ensure you've got a good vet, not one whose a Vet because they couldn't find work
